535,116 is a composite number, even.
535,116 (five hundred thirty-five thousand one hundred sixteen) is an even 6-digit number. It is a composite number with 24 divisors, and factors as 2² × 3 × 19 × 2,347. Its proper divisors sum to 779,764,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x82A4C.
